TOWN OF MIDDLETOWN, RI

A Resolution Endorsing the Goals of the 2023 Ride Island Bike Plan

WHEREAS, "Ride Island" is an initiative with the goal of creating an island-wide network of connected bicycle and pedestrian infrastructure on Aquidneck Island; and

WHEREAS, the Ride Island initiative is working collaboratively with the Aquidneck Island municipal administrators and planners, elected officials, and resident advocates in Newport, Middletown and Portsmouth, and Naval Station Newport; and

WHEREAS, Ride Island is using industry best practices and evidence-based research to identify solutions to Aquidneck Island's infrastructure needs and the desires of the communities; and

WHEREAS, Ride Island is a collaborative initiative, serving the interests of the Aquidneck Island community and providing assistance to municipal planning departments by identifying funding opportunities, providing relevant sources and research on best practices, and facilitating collaboration among the municipalities and the Naval Station and

WHEREAS, the Ride Island Bike Plan of 2023 is based on recommendations in existing studies including the Aquidneck Island West Side Master Plan (2005); Aquidneck Island Transportation Study (2011); the Rhode Island Bicycle Mobility Plan (2020); Keep Newport Moving (2022), RIDOT State Transportation Improvement Program (20022-2031); the municipal Comprehensive Land Use Plans of Newport (2017), Middletown (2014) and Portsmouth (2021); and more; and

WHEREAS, the Ride Island Bike Plan of 2023 addresses gaps in these previous works by incorporating additional transportation data and engagement of previously underrepresented stakeholders and a gathering of representative advisors.

N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ED that the Middletown Town Council does hereby indicate our endorsement of the overall goals of the Bike Plan of 2023 "to expand the bicycle network strategically" and "to safely and efficiently connect people and places so that riding a bicycle in Rhode Island is safe and fun for all ages.
